    R Madhavan Was ‘Heartbroken’ When Rehnaa Hai Terre Dil Mein Flopped At Box Office; ‘I Had Left No Stone Unturned To Make The Film The Way It Was Supposed To’

    R Madhavan recalled how heartbroken he felt when his 2001 film Rehnaa Hai Terre Dil Mein failed to perform well at the box office.

    r-madhavan-heartbroken-when-rhtdm-flopped

    Gautham Menon’s Rehnaa Hai Terre Dil Mein starring R Madhavan, Dia Mirza and Saif Ali Khan has earned a cult status over the years, and is a favourite with the rom-com lovers. Surprisingly, when the film initially released in 2001, it didn’t fare well at the box office.

    Recently when the film’s leading man R Madhavan attended the 55th International Film Festival of India (IFFI) in Goa for the premiere of his film Hisaab Barabar, the actor walked down the memory lane in a chat with ANI, and recalled how disappointed he was when Rehnaa Hai Terre Dil Mein‘s failure at the box office.

    Madhavan shared, “When it first released, it didn’t do well; it was a flop. So I remember being heartbroken. I had gone to all the temples and made sure I had left no stone unturned to make the film the way it was supposed to, but it was heartbreaking. Little did I realize that fortune and fate had a big story for me.”

    Further, the ‘Shaitaan’ actor said that it feels wonderful that the film was re-released after 25 years and earned more that it did during its original run. For the unversed, the Madhavan-Dia Mirza starrer saw a re-release in cinema halls in August this year to mark the film’s 25th anniversary.

    Speaking about it, Madhavan said, “It (re)released after 25 years and made more money than it did originally. It’s wonderful to be recognised for doing a film 25 years later.”

    Rehnaa Hai Terre Dil, helmed by Gautham Menon, was a remake of the director’s own Tamil film Minnale which featured Madhavan, Reema Sen and Abbas. Madhavan reprised his role in the Hindi remake as well. Rehnaa Hai Terre Dil Mein marked Dia Mirza’s debut in Bollywood.
